Position Overview:

The Medical Technologist/Lab Technician (MT/MLT) is responsible for the performance of laboratory services according to established and approved protocols at Winona Health. This includes phlebotomy and the performance of procedures that are defined under CLIA '88 as waived, moderate and high complexity laboratory tests.

  • The MT/MLT is knowledgeable in the technical area(s) to which they are assigned and is expected to resolve technical equipment and procedural problems to completion. The position requires a detail-oriented individual to perform both clerical and technical tasks where problem-solving skills are frequently utilized.
  • The MT/MLT works in partnership with hospital staff in providing lab services, and assists with the teaching/training of lab staff and other hospital staff in laboratory policies/procedures/principles as assigned.
  • The MT/MLT will be required to work in more than one discipline of clinical laboratory work as so requested by leadership. Other areas of accountability include the evaluation and troubleshooting of test system performance (both existing and new), and Quality Assurance/Quality Improvement activities related to lab services.
  • The MT/MLT will work with other hospital staff to efficiently and effectively meet the organization’s mission and service standards.
  • Performs phlebotomy procedures in compliance with NAACLS standards and established laboratory policies and procedures. Follows universal precautions and assures specimen collection protocols and knowledge of patient effects.
  • Performs moderate and (if applicable) high complexity laboratory testing. Prioritizes work flow, performs multiple analysis in a timely and accurate manner. Documents and reports lab results.
  • Provides all clerical duties necessary to complete test services assigned.
  • Performs test system quality assurance, collates data and evaluates results. Takes corrective actions and documents such when appropriate.
  • Monitors, assesses and troubleshoots test systems.
  • Understands the operation and maintenance of all equipment pertinent to job performance.
  • Reads and interprets documents to include operating and maintenance instructions and procedure manuals.
  • Performs required instrumentation maintenance, performance checks, calibration, correction of analytical problems and documentation.
  • Maintains proficiency in all assigned work duties
  • Perform DOT and BAT drug screens after hours as needed
  • Understands and uses PPD (personal protective devices) appropriately. Maintains a safe work environment and holds self and others accountable for safe work practices.
  • Ensures that work duties are in complete compliance with all regulatory and accreditation standards from agencies that review WH.
  • Communicates verbally and in writing in a clear and concise manner. Communicates all service issues and concerns to the appropriate individuals.
  • Participates in teaching of students and other health professionals as required.
  • Other laboratory duties as assigned

Essential Skills and Experience:

Required:

  • Education level for MLT:
    • Academic high school diploma, successful completion an accredited medical laboratory training course of at least 50 weeks, HHS (HEW) proficiency exam certification, and have a minimum of three years full-time equivalent experience in a CAP accredited clinical laboratory.
    • Associate degree in Medical Laboratory Technician program completion
  • Education level for MT:
    • Bachelor’s Degree in Medical Technologist/Clinical Laboratory Scientist (MT/CLS) or equivalent
  • Able to communicate effectively in English, both verbally and in writing. Ability to be self‑motivated and to work for periods without direct supervision. Ability to manage time through prioritization of tasks.
  • Individual must meet requirements for performing moderate and high complexity testing as defined by federal licensing guidelines (CLIA) and accreditation agencies (CAP).
  • Competent to perform high quality general tests in all assigned laboratory areas with accuracy, skill and dedication.
  • Ability to perform multiple tasks simultaneously and accurately.
  • Basic computer skills.

Preferred:

  • Certification required from ASCP within 1 year of hire or as determined with Laboratory director. Must maintain registration as required by registry association.
